Cons: Not so great at getting inside near the rollers. Gums up fast unless you use some sort of degreaser on it every now and then.
Recommendation: This tool provides a very nice costmetic cleaning for the outer links of your chain. The problem is that it doesn't really do a great job getting down into the rollers and getting that gunk out. The rollers are the main part that holds grime and grease so the chain is still dirty after cleaning with the scrubber. The brushes get gunked up kinda fast too. I find it easier to throw some degreaser in the unit and run the chain through that a couple of times. Then, wash that stuff out and refill the unit with soapy water and run the chain through one last time. Relube the rollers and wipe clean with a towel and the chain is clean enough and ready to roll.

Cons: Does a poor job cleaning anything other than the outside of the links; rollers and inner links don't get touched. Gunks up pretty bad after about 5 uses. A cheaper and much better cleaning solution is just to use two empty jars; one filled with mineral spirits and one filled with hot soapy water.
Recommendation: Don't waste your $15. Fill a jar with mineral spirits, drop your chain in and shake. Then drop the chain into another jar with hot soapy water and shake. Voila! Clean chain. Pour off the clean mineral spirits after the gunk sinks to the bottom in a day and reuse next time. This thing does little more than hit the outside of the chain and does VERY little for the rollers and links that need to be cleared of grit and dirt to make your chain run smoothly.
